Job Title

Consultant

Job Description

The consultant will work on the successful delivery of projects for clients as a member of project teams within a market program. This includes providing support to the project manager with initiating, planning, executing, monitoring, and controlling and closing projects. As part of a project team, the consultant will maintain relationships with clients and key decision makers to help identify follow-on business opportunities and maintain customer intelligence.

About Us

We set out more than 160 years ago to promote the security of life and property at sea and preserve the natural environment. Today, we remain true to our mission and continue to support organizations facing a rapidly evolving seascape of challenging regulations and new technologies. Through it all, we are anchored by a vision and mission that help our clients find clarity in uncertain times. ABS is a global leader in marine and offshore classification and other innovative safety, quality, and environmental services. We're at the forefront of supporting the global energy transition at sea, the application of remote and autonomous marine systems, cutting-edge technical solutions, and many more exciting advancements. Our commitment to safety, reliability, and efficiency is ever-present, guiding our clients to safer and more efficient operations.
